Thirsting blade is going to do some real good work for you … WebJan 14, 2024 · Warforged: "You can don only armor with which you have proficiency. To don armor, you must incorporate it into your body over the course of 1 hour, during which you remain in contact with the armor. To doff armor, you must spend 1 hour removing it. WebA warforged is considered to be wearing whatever armor it currently has attached for all mechanical purposes: feats, spells, class features. If the warforged has metal armor attached, it’s vulnerable to heat metal. WebAug 2, 2024 · Integrated Protection, which bestows upon the Warforged special defensive layers that can be enchanted with their armor. They receive these benefits: AC + 1; They can only wear armor they’re proficient with and incorporate it into themselves for an hour. They remove armor for an hour in the same way.
